What's the meaning of "gridlock", apart from a traffic jam?
Context:
An accurate gridlock between the unit and the ship is maintained.

Gridlock is most commonly used to refer to disagreements between political parties in Parliament or Congress.
edit: in your example, gridlock means a situation in which nothing can move or proceed in any direction.
